What temperature should I bake seafood at?

450 degrees Fahrenheit is the commonly recommended temperature to bake fish fillets and steaks.

Is it better to bake fish covered or uncovered?

Is it better to bake fish covered or uncovered? Covering your fish in foil while baking helps to create a steaming effect which will cut down on cooking time and keep the flavors of the fish inside. If you want your baked fish golden brown, never cover it with aluminum foil when putting it into an oven for baking.

What flavors go well with scallops?

What herbs go with scallops?

  • Thyme: The delicate flavor of thyme and French-vibe make it the top fit for scallops.
  • Tarragon: It’s got a subtle licorice nuance and fresh flavor. …
  • Parsley (Italian or flat leaf): The fresh bite of parsley is another natural choice.
  • Chives: The delicate onion garlic flavor works well here.

What is the best fish to bake or broil?

Rich fish (salmon, bluefish, mackerel) are best cooked skin-on and broiled for about 10 minutes, skin side up. These need little more than a proper seasoning of salt and a sheen of olive oil to help crisp the skin.
